.NET Core: .NET Core is an open-source, cross-platform framework for building modern, cloud-enabled apps using C#, F#, and ASP.NET. It allows developers to create web apps, services, libraries and console apps that run on Windows, Linux and macOS.

LiveSession: LiveSession is a live chat and customer support software. It allows companies to interact with website visitors in real-time through live chat, voice, and video features. Key capabilities include agent assignment rules, chat transfer, customizable widgets, reporting tools, and third-party integrations.

Key Features Comparison

.NET Core
.NET Core Features
  • Cross-platform - runs on Windows, Linux and macOS
  • Open source and community-focused
  • Backwards compatibility with .NET Framework
  • Built-in dependency injection
  • Lightweight and high performance
  • Flexible deployment options
LiveSession
LiveSession Features
  • Real-time chat
  • Voice and video calling
  • Agent assignment rules
  • Chat transfer
  • Customizable chat widgets
  • Third-party integrations
  • Reporting and analytics
